Evan Williams, a multifaceted American actor and comedian, has been ceaselessly injecting a dash of humor into the darker, more somber aspects of life in the bustling metropolis of New York City since his relocation from the tranquil landscape of North Carolina in the year 2012.
This remarkable person has garnered widespread acclaim for their impressive performances on multiple mediums, including the prestigious Comedy Central's Roast Battle II, where they demonstrated an extraordinary flair for comedy, captivating audiences with their razor-sharp wit, clever wordplay, and unbridled energy, solidifying their reputation as a master of the craft.
It was a truly momentous occasion in the life of the talented individual in question, as in 2016, he was bestowed with the esteemed distinction of being named a 'New Face' at the renowned Montreal Just For Laughs Festival, a milestone that unequivocally underscored his burgeoning reputation as a luminary in the realm of comedy.
In conjunction with his numerous television appearances, Williams has also made a notable guest appearance in the Season 6 premiere of the highly acclaimed and widely recognized FX series, The Americans, which has garnered significant critical acclaim and praise.
Notably, his remarkable professional achievements have resulted in his inclusion on Complex Magazine's esteemed compilation of the most outstanding and influential comedians of a relatively youthful age, specifically those under the age of thirty.
Furthermore, his impressive career trajectory has also garnered him recognition on Addiction.com's curated list of notable and accomplished comedians who have successfully navigated the challenges of sobriety, featuring a selection of five exceptional individuals who have made significant contributions to the world of comedy while maintaining a sober lifestyle.
Noted comedian Williams' impressive portfolio of work has garnered widespread recognition and acclaim, with his talents showcased in highly respected publications like TimeOut NY, The Interrobang, and The New York Times.
Beyond his impressive stand-up comedy career, this talented individual has also made a splash in the world of television, featuring on the popular MTV show "Bugging Out". Additionally, he has demonstrated his exceptional comedic skills by being a finalist on Seeso's esteemed competition, "New York's Funniest", which highlights the most outstanding comedic talent the city has to offer.
